A historic 1928 estate originally built by Bel-Air founder Alphonzo Bell has been listed for sale at $32.5 million. The current owner purchased the property for $5.5 million over a decade ago. Following the acquisition, the owner undertook a five-year restoration project to bring the mansion back to its former glory. The Spanish-style residence blends original architectural features with modern amenities, reflecting both its historic roots and contemporary comfort.
Sourabh Sahu, a technology professional, was among the employees affected by Oracle's latest round of layoffs. His wife Pooja Sahu shared an emotional post on social media expressing her grief over the development. Sourabh had spent 12 years at the company before losing his job. The post highlighted the human cost of large-scale corporate layoffs in the tech industry.

The US State Department informed Congress on Tuesday of plans to redirect $52 million in foreign military financing to Latin American allies. The funds will be diverted away from Slovakia, North Macedonia, Tunisia, and Iraq. The beneficiary nations are Panama, Peru, Ecuador, and Colombia. This reprogramming signals a shift in US military aid priorities toward the Latin American region.

AI researcher Sara Hooker has pushed back against growing fears that artificial intelligence poses an existential threat to humanity. Her comments come in the wake of heightened alarm expressed by prominent AI leaders over the past week. In an interview with NDTV, Hooker stated she does not consider human extinction a credible risk from AI. She offered her perspective as a counterpoint to the wave of concern that has recently dominated discussions in the AI industry.
